Early Life and Family Background in New Jersey
Diane Addonizio grew up in Monmouth County, New Jersey, in a structured and family-focused environment. Her father, Frank Addonizio, was a war veteran and worked as a security director, while her mother, Maria Cecere, was a homemaker. She was raised in a traditional Catholic household where discipline and education were important parts of daily life. This early upbringing helped shape Diane Addonizio’s personality and values. Her childhood focused on family, responsibility, and learning, which later influenced both her career choices and her role as a mother.
Education and Academic Achievements
Diane Addonizio completed her early education at Red Bank High School before continuing her studies at Villanova University. There, she studied classical studies and graduated with a bachelor’s degree in 1985. After completing her undergraduate education, she went on to attend the University of Southern California, where she earned her law degree in 1987. Her education provided a strong foundation in both law and humanities, which later supported her professional journey.
How Diane Addonizio Met Howie Long
Diane Addonizio met Howie Long while both were students at Villanova University. At the time, Howie Long was a year ahead of her and was already playing football. Their first interaction included watching an NFL game together, which helped them connect early in their relationship. Over time, their bond grew stronger during their college years. Before any fame or public attention, they became college sweethearts and built a relationship based on shared experiences.
Marriage to Howie Long and Wedding Details

After dating during college, Diane Addonizio and Howie Long got engaged after he signed his NFL contract in 1981. They were married on June 27, 1982, shortly after completing their studies. Their marriage has lasted for over 40 years, making it one of the longest-lasting relationships connected to the NFL. Over time, their strong partnership has remained stable and private, even while being connected to a high-profile sports career.

Diane Addonizio’s Children and Their Careers
Chris Long (Born 1985)
Chris Long is the eldest son of Diane Addonizio. He became a professional football player and played as a defensive end. During his career, he played for teams such as the New England Patriots and the Philadelphia Eagles. He achieved major success in the NFL and became a two-time Super Bowl champion.
Kyle Long (Born 1988)
Kyle Long is the second son of Diane Addonizio. He played in the NFL as an offensive guard, mainly for the Chicago Bears. Throughout his career, he received multiple Pro Bowl selections, which shows his performance and recognition in professional football.
Howie Long Jr. (Born 1990)
Howie Long Jr. is the youngest son of Diane Addonizio. Instead of playing professionally, he works in football operations and business roles. He has been associated with the Las Vegas Raiders organization, contributing to the sport in a different way.

Diane Addonizio as an Author
In 2000, Diane Addonizio published her book He’s Just My Dad!. The book focuses on athletes and their relationships with their children. It includes interviews and insights that show how sports figures interact with their families. This work reflects her interest in both sports and parenting, combining personal experiences with a broader topic.
Involvement in Football Safety and Community Work
She has taken part in football safety awareness programs. She participated in panel discussions at the Walter Payton Center, where topics included safety and education for young football players. Her involvement in these discussions shows her interest in improving awareness around the sport. She has also been connected to NFL-related initiatives and advisory efforts focused on safety and community support.
